1967 Ad Vauxhall Viva Saloon Models British Automobiles - ORIGINAL LN1 XGUA5 It was a part ofThis is an original 1967 color print ad for the Vauxhall Viva cars including: the Viva Saloon; S. L. 90; Viva de Luxe; Viva S. L.; Brabham Viva; Viva 90; S. L. Estate; and the de Luxe Estate, from Vauxhall Motors Limited of Luton, Bedfordshire, England, a company owned by GM. CONDITION This 44+ year old Item is rated Near Mint Very Fine. No aging. No natural defects. No surface rub. No tears. No water damage. There is a crease in the center of this ad
